Illinois: Missing man, Paul Carr, found dead in a field
Wauconda police in Illinois have identified a dead body found in a field after responding to reports of an “unoccupied suspicious vehicle” with “a large amount of blood inside.”
Police used K9 units to search the surrounding area when they discovered the body of Paul T. Carr.
Carr, 41, was a physical therapist who worked at Barrington Orthopedics in Buffalo Grove.
Authorities located the body of a man in a large cornfield nearby.
Wauconda police say the Carr had been reported missing Sunday morning to Buffalo Grove police.
Wauconda police have not release any information about how Carr died.
They said they will wait for the results of an autopsy from the Lake County coroner, Howard Cooper.
